    Understanding Latitude and Longitude

    Before we dive into the specifics of Washington, D.C.'s coordinates, let's establish a foundational understanding of latitude and longitude. These two coordinates form the basis of the geographic coordinate system, a system used to pinpoint locations on the surface of the Earth.

    Latitude: Measuring North and South

    Latitude measures the angular distance of a point north or south of the Earth's equator. The equator is assigned a latitude of 0°, with values increasing towards the North Pole (90° N) and the South Pole (90° S). Lines of constant latitude are known as parallels, and they run east-west around the globe.

    Longitude: Measuring East and West

    Longitude measures the angular distance of a point east or west of the Prime Meridian. The Prime Meridian, which passes through Greenwich, England, is assigned a longitude of 0°. Values increase eastward to 180° E and westward to 180° W. Lines of constant longitude are called meridians, and they converge at the North and South Poles.

    Pinpointing Washington, D.C.: The Coordinates

    The latitude and longitude of Washington, D.C., are often cited as 38.9072° N, 77.0369° W. However, it's crucial to understand that this is a representative coordinate, typically referring to the center point of the District of Columbia. The city sprawls across a significant area, and different locations within the city will have slightly different coordinates.

    This central coordinate is valuable for general purposes, such as locating Washington, D.C., on a map or using it as a reference point for navigation systems. However, for more precise applications, such as addressing specific locations within the city, a more granular approach is needed.

    The Challenges of Defining a Single Coordinate for a Large City

    Defining a single latitude and longitude for a sprawling metropolitan area like Washington, D.C., presents several challenges:

    • Spatial Extent: Washington, D.C., covers a significant geographical area. Assigning a single coordinate overlooks the variations in latitude and longitude across the city's boundaries.
    • Defining the "Center": Determining the precise "center" of the city can be subjective and depend on the methodology used. Different approaches, such as using the geographic centroid or the population centroid, could yield slightly different results.
    • Applications: The choice of coordinate depends heavily on the intended application. For instance, the coordinate for the White House would differ from the coordinate for the National Mall, even though both are within Washington, D.C.
